=head1 NAME
App::Pinto::Command::log - show the revision logs of a stack
=head1 VERSION
version 0.089
=head1 SYNOPSIS
pinto --root=REPOSITORY_ROOT log [STACK] [OPTIONS]
=head1 DESCRIPTION
!! THIS COMMAND IS EXPERIMENTAL !!
This command shows the commit logs for the stack. To see the precise
changes in any particular commit, use the L<App::Pinto::Command::show>
command.
=head1 COMMAND ARGUMENTS
As an alternative to the C<--stack> option, you can specify it as
an argument. So the following examples are equivalent:
pinto --root REPOSITORY_ROOT log --stack=dev
pinto --root REPOSITORY_ROOT log dev
A C<stack> argument will override anything specified with the
C<--stack> option. If the stack is not specified using neither
argument nor option, then the logs of the default stack will
be shown.
=head1 COMMAND OPTIONS
=over 4
=item --stack NAME
=item -s NAME
Show the logs of the stack with the given NAME. Defaults to the name
of whichever stack is currently marked as the default stack. Use the
L<stacks|App::Pinto::Command::stack> command to see the stacks in the
repository.
=back
